The Voice 8 Top 12 Live Blog and VIDEOS

The Voice 8 Top 12 take the stage tonight with the help of Guest Mentor, Reba! We’re live blogging the performances right here.

A terrific show tonight! The women RULED. Meghan Linsey’s return to country put her BACK in the game. That’s the singer I remember from her Steel Magnolia days. Also gaining ground is Kimberly Nichole, who had TWO powerful performances in a row. Mia Z continues to display her impressive vocal chops and musical smarts. Koryn Hawthorne delivered a mighty fierce rendition of “Stronger.” I think India Carney had a good performance tonight, but judging by her iTunes numbers–which continue to be low compared to her fellow singers–she’s still not connecting.

The boys didn’t make as big a splash this week, except for Sawyer Fredericks, who seems to be bullet proof at this point. Despite performing early-ish in the line up, he managed to zoom to the top of the iTunes chart. Brian Johnson, who performed second, isn’t repeating his solid chart success from last week. Corey Kent White is also languishing on the chart (as of midnight or so on the east coast) when I was SURE his Jason Aldean cover would be a hit. Maybe the country folk are focusing on Sawyer and Meghan tonight.

This week? I’d say Team Pharrell has it going on, with Mia Z, Sawyer Fredericks, and Koryn Hawthorne ALL delivering. But Christina and Blake both had team members who left their mark–Kimberly Nichole and Meghan Linsey respectively.

ETA: Forgot to mention Reba! Engaging and forthcoming, she had some good advice for the contestants–particularly on how to connect to an audience.
